#5e046e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5e046e is composed of 36.9% red, 1.6%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.5% cyan, 96.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 290.9 degrees, a saturation of 93% and a lightness of 22.4%. #5e046e color hex could be obtained by blending #bc08dc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#5e046e color description : Very dark magenta.

#5e046e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5e046e has RGB values of R:94, G:4,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 6161518.

Shades and Tints of #5e046e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d010f is the darkest color, while #fefb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#5e046e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#393939 is the less saturated color, while #5e046e is the most saturated one.
